WebTrue limpets scrape off and feed on algal spores and bits of plant matter from the rocks. They do this with the radula, which is a ribbon-like tongue with many teeth, at least twelve in each row. Equal-size blunt radular teeth are present in limpets that feed on coral lineage. Limpets that feed on rock substrates have unequal-sized, sharp teeth. WebThe radula has many teeth in each row.
